1979: The Birth of a Legend – Hermès Eau d'Orange Verte

The year was 1979. Disco was fading, punk was peaking, and a revolutionary fragrance was about to emerge from the creative heart of Hermès. Eau d'Orange Verte, conceived by the legendary perfumer Françoise Caron, wasn't just another citrus scent; it was a paradigm shift. It wasn't simply about the bright, zesty burst of orange; it was about the multifaceted nature of the fruit, its bitter peel, its verdant leaves, its subtle sweetness, and the unexpected nuances that unfolded over time.

This wasn't a perfume designed to be fleeting; it was crafted to linger, to evolve, to tell a story on the skin. Caron's genius lay in her ability to capture the entire essence of the orange, from the vibrant zest to the slightly bitter undertones of the rind, seamlessly blending these notes with a surprising array of other elements. This complexity, this departure from the norm, is what solidified Eau d'Orange Verte's place in fragrance history. It's a perfume that defies easy categorization, defying expectations of what a citrus fragrance could be. It's a testament to the power of unexpected combinations and the artistry of high perfumery.

The immediate success of Eau d'Orange Verte cemented its status as a classic. Its unexpected blend of citrus, green notes, and subtle spice resonated with a broad audience, defying traditional gender boundaries. This unisex appeal, a relatively novel concept in the late 1970s, further contributed to its enduring popularity.
